Smoke cleanup services involve the thorough removal of soot, smoke residues, and odors resulting from fires or smoke-related incidents. These professionals use specialized cleaning techniques and equipment to eliminate stubborn residues that can settle into walls, ceilings, carpets, and other surfaces. The goal is to restore the property to a clean, safe condition by addressing the lingering effects of smoke that can cause discoloration, unpleasant smells, and potential health concerns. Proper smoke cleanup is essential after fire damage to ensure that the property is properly restored and that residual smoke odors do not persist.
This service helps resolve a variety of problems associated with smoke damage. Smoke residues can cause staining and discoloration on walls, furniture, and fabrics, making spaces look dirty and uninviting. Additionally, smoke odors can linger long after a fire has been extinguished, creating discomfort and reducing indoor air quality. Without proper cleaning, these odors and residues can also lead to ongoing problems such as mold growth or respiratory issues. Smoke cleanup services are designed to address these issues effectively, helping to eliminate odors and restore the environment to a healthier state.

The overview below groups typical Smoke Cleanup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Everett,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Basic smoke cleanup for minor areas typically costs between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ering localized damage and surface cleaning. Larger or more affected spaces may require additional services, increasing the overall cost.
Moderate Damage Restoration - For moderate smoke damage affecting multiple rooms or larger areas,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common and involve more extensive cleaning and deodorization efforts.
Extensive Damage or Structural Cleaning - Large-scale smoke cleanup, including structural cleaning and extensive deodorization, can range from $3,500 to $7,000.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this spectrum, which is reserved for significant damage or complex situations.
Full Property Restoration - Complete restoration for heavily damaged properties can exceed $10,000, especially for large homes or commercial spaces. These higher costs are typical for comprehensive projects that involve extensive cleaning, repairs, and rebuilding efforts.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
